My husband and I and another couple spent 4 nights in Santa Monica 2 years ago. The restaurants we really loved were:

Chinois on Main (Wolfgang Puck)
Valentino (Italian)
One Pico (in the Shutters Hotel -very elegant/romantic)
Border Grill (upscale Mexican)

We also had drinks at the Ivy one night ... which was very quaint and romantic.

Ocean Avenue Seafood is the best seafood place in Santa Monica, hands down (I work up the street). Joe's Restaurant down in Venice is one of the best California Cuisine joints you'll find in the country. Chinois on Main is a Wolfgang Puck eatery, but it's considered one of the best in his empire.
